Cloverleigh Cottage

Cloverleigh is a traditional stone built croft house with seas views. It is a charming, tastefully decorated and homely place to stay. It is maintained to a high standard with all modern conveniences.

The lounge is warm and cosy with an open hearth fire and dining area. There are two double bedrooms and one twin bedded room. The house is has electric heating throughout with fridge/freezer, dishwasher, washing machine, tumble dryer, microwave, television and DVD player. All bed linen, towels and coal are provided. Bathroom has a bath with electric shower. The croft house also has a secluded rear garden with garden furniture and barbeque. It also has an attached locked barn, ideal for bike storage.

Brora has a large sandy beach, harbour and recreational facilities that can be arranged including fishing trips, golf, curling (seasonal), shooting and pony trecking. Bicycle hire is available, ideal for exploring the back roads around Brora. To visit in Brora is the famous Clynelish Distillery and the heritage centre.. The local swimming pool, which also has a sauna and equipped gymnasium, is located only a few miles away in the village of Golspie. Tennis courts are also available.

Local walking includes Ben Horn (521m) and views around Loch Brora. In Golspie there is the recently opened mountain bike course, intermediate to difficult, based from just north of the town centre car park.
